The Dutch Research Council (NWO) and the São Paulo Research Foundation (FAPESP) are the hosts of this year’s Annual Meeting with the topic of Rewarding and Recognizing Scientists and Climate Change Research.
For this GRC (Global Research Council), taking place upcoming days in The Hague, I’ll have the incredible opportunity to be the rapporteur of the side event of the Global South representatives discussing Leveraging Transdisciplinary Research for Community Impact. Ultra flattered+
The GRC comprises heads of science and engineering funding agencies, that promotes the sharing of data and best practices for high-quality collab among funding agencies worldwide.
